Madhya Pradesh gets new Advocate General, as state govt appoints Rajendra Tiwari

Senior advocate of the high court of Madhya Pradesh, Rajendra Tiwari, has been appointed as the new Advocate General of the state.

According to a Bar and Bench report, the appointment came following the change in government in the state that led the former Advocate General Purushaindra Kaurav to resign from the post of AG on December 12. Kaurav had been serving as AG of Madhya Pradesh since his appointment in June 2017.

Tiwari enrolled as an advocate in June 1964 and has practiced at the MP High Court at Jabalpur and the lower courts for over 54 years. The veteran lawyer has also served as Deputy Advocate General of the state from 1984 to 1988. He was designated as a Senior Advocate in 1995.
